Output de3eb91569d3839e3aef1b2b5ddacd7e2cd5bc4af3deea183f439bfbdfbd7f8a:0

value
29674600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 920584b156e92a3be164163bfe9478d4e03ba161 OP_EQUALVERIFY OP_CHECKSIG
address
1EK6GRoStUcsxB8WaoV56nSf6NEPKCnXW2
transaction
de3eb91569d3839e3aef1b2b5ddacd7e2cd5bc4af3deea183f439bfbdfbd7f8a
spent
true